Compact EGC Amplifier Model 93250
The
new Compact Electronic Gain Control (EGC) Amplifier for trunk and
distribution applications expands the flexibility of Scientific
Atlanta's EGC amplifier family. The EGC amplifiers feature limited
service interruptions for VoIP service during amplifier setup; user-selectable
bandwidth of 870MHz or 1GHz; return-path bandwidth of up to 200MHz
for future-friendly bandwidth expansion; remote addressability via
the ROSAź Element Management System aiming at reducing truck rolls
and lowering inventory by delivering user-selectable gain and slope
while minimizing the number of plug ins. Download the

Our flexible, software upgradeable FPGA/DSP architecture in the
newest release of two encoders is built to provide remarkable HD
and SD picture quality improvements. The latest achievements in
picture quality on the MPEG-4
AVC HD Encoder D9054™ have boosted video quality
by more than 40 percent since we demonstrated the encoder at IBC
2006. The latest achievements are made through improved high-level
and low-level rate control, dynamic and hierarchical GOP structures
featured in optimized GOP selection algorithms, Picture AFF and
better compensation of special effects (e.g. fades, flashes) through
rate control, explicit weighted prediction and better scene change
detection.
In the new release of the MPEG-4
AVC SD Encoder D9034™we also provide highly
improved picture quality, which is derived by continued focus on
the implementation of more H.264 tools like Picture Adaptive Frame/Field
coding. This tool can provide visible improvements in picture quality
on interlaced material including fast and full picture motion like
in live sport events. Other focus areas in this new s/w version
have been the implementation of a more advanced scene change detection
mechanism, an improved rate control at both macro block level,
as well as at high level. Last but not least, the motion section
of the encoder has been improved with larger search regions and
a more enhanced motion compensation for more effective motion vector
coding.
Cost-efficient MPEG-2 SD Encoding
To address the need for cost-efficient MPEG-2 SD
encoding, we introduce the Local Program MPEG-2 SD D9022™Encoder
as an efficient solution for headend applications in cable and IP
delivery systems, and local and regional program insertion in DVB-T
play-outs. The encoder is designed to provide composite interface
as well as SDI and comes with 2 audio stereo pairs. It can support
the most typical DVB VBI, and also aspect ratio cont rol
as well as AFD, and has a new advanced management feature that helps
enable the user to manage the D9022 via the IP streaming ports.
The management traffic can be protected by the IPsec-protocol. Download

DVB-S2
- The Standard for HD Transport
HD channel launches
all over the world can benefit from the 30 percent bandwidth savings
available with DVB-S2 technology. Anticipating
the acceleration of digital switch over to DVB-T broadcasting and
the growing need for HDTV distribution, Scientific Atlanta has launched
its Titan™ DVB-S2 digital
Satellite Receiver, adding DVB S2 capability to the Galaxy
platform. One Galaxy chassis can contain up to 12 receivers and,
when combined with the Indus™ MKII TS Descrambler, be used
to create an extremely dense acquisition system for digital turn-around
solutions. The Titan S2 can be purchased as a DVB-S receiving device
and can be upgraded with DVB-S2 receiving capabilities through a
simple license upgrade, making current DVB-S investments future
